Lofotpils er kremaktig med god fylde og aroma, og en antydning av gjær og brød. Avslutningen er lett bitter, tørr og delikat, som et resultat av det fantastiske vannet fra fjellene i Lofoten.
Lofotpils Pilsner passer til flere anledninger, enten i kombinasjon med ulike typer mat, eller som ren tørsteslukker i selskap med gode venner.

From the keg at a Henningsvaer restaurant. Pours a clear golden with a white head. Aromas & tastes of corn & yeast. Moderate body. Slightly sweet light bitter finish.

Canned, huge thanks Gaute! Hazy yellow-golden bod, white head, pretty big to begin with, lower retention. Floral hops and dusty stale malty notes in the aroma. Bit flat taste, floral, minerally, again the same stale feeling maltiness, bit rough, vague bitterness, almost none. Sweetish, but not too full. Very non-pilsnerish honestly. Canned (from Rema 1000 Kirkenes). Golden colour, mediumsized fluffy head. Aroma is floral, grassy, herbal and some mild sweet malty notes. Flavour is floral, grassy, some mild herbal and some wooden notes. Nice sweetness to it, and a good crisp maltiness making it refreshing.

330 ml aluminium bottle, from Bunnpris Sauda. ABV is 4.7%. Slowly gushing bottle. Crystal clear pale golden colour, moderate to small white head. Malty aroma, hints of hay. Also hints of grassy hops. Medium sweet but still fairly crisp flavour, acceptable herbal hops in the medium bitter finish.

Bottle. Has a clear straw colour with an off-white head. Light aroma of hay, grass, sweet corn and some pear. Light flavour as well with grass, dry hay, grains and some sweet corn and cooked vegetables. Light and sparkly mouth feel, light body and bitterness. A light and a little unbalanced pilsener.
